I hope that Ore Valley Housing Association are able to get people to get involved in their scheme to have areas of Lochgelly revamped.
They advertised that they were to encourage people to walk around the town with them pointing out sites that need attention.
You see there are too many people prepared to gripe away in the background but when it comes to putting their head above the parapit they are not so keen.
You see the regeneration theme to succeed totally will need everyone to play their part in ensuring that areas needing attention are given that attention.
And the fact is only local people are aware of the parts of their district that need that attention, you cannot expect people, who even although they may work in the town, to know every neuk and cranny.
Local activists such as Davie Kinnell are the sort of people who can make a difference to this fact finding exercise.
And the thing is even if people have not been able to join in the walks around the town it does not mean that their information is not needed.
No the people at Ore Valley would be delighted to receive a visit during which you can impart your advice.
If you know a site which needs attention then get round to Ore Valley's Bank Street office and let them know. They will be verfy grateful.
REGEN MAN, Lochgelly.
